Output 12946481f34a32e5e2c698fc048a38048b2c0ee33f82a56780a3638b65b1df7b:3

value
19982168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b9c4c5c7e522d93d69f0224dead0c855cf46ac OP_EQUAL
address
3Ku4w9dW4hWrBMgeWf2TJhRKow7y1F1FvX
transaction
12946481f34a32e5e2c698fc048a38048b2c0ee33f82a56780a3638b65b1df7b
spent
true